Hi all - my engagement ring is a claw prong set aquamarine (stock picture from website shown with diamond), but I would much prefer a bezel setting. My local jeweler told me it would be difficult to modify and didn't want to try it. I am emailing other local jewelers for their professional opinion as well. It's a platinum ring with two small diamonds on either side of the center stone. I was told that any attempt to modify the setting would damage the diamonds because of the temperature required to work with platinum. I am just not a "prong" kind of girl and need to find a way to make this ring more my style. Any advice would be much appreciated.

FWIW a highly skilled bench person could likely do what you want, but I don't think the finished piece would flow nicely, and for the cost in terms of labor, me personally instead I'd just remove the Aqua, sell the current setting, and have a new similar setting custom-made to incorporate a bezel.

Making this ring into a bezel style setting is not too difficult, but it is time consuming and a bit spendy. This would be best accomplished by removing the stone, cutting out the existing head, fabricating the new bezel head and laser welding it into the setting. My present employer has a laser which we use daily for tacking things together and making repairs which would be impossible otherwise. Using the laser with platinum makes a fantastic join and since it's a weld, shows no color difference from the parent metal and is stronger than any other method of joining. Call around and look for a custom shop which can make the head and has a laser for welding the parts together.

I would only get the most skilled jeweler to do a bezel, as the setting process can easily chip a stone, especially an aqua, and especially in platinum.
